7 Popular Clear Aligners Myths Busted

Let's review the most prevalent fallacies about aligners that people in India hear, along with the facts.

Myth 1: Aligners Can Only Fix Small Gaps
People often believe that aligners are only beneficial if there is little gap between the teeth.

The Reality: Aligners are capable of far more than just filling in minor gaps. Crowding, crossbites, overbites, and underbites are all problems that modern aligner systems are meant to address. These days, dentists use 3D scans to arrange treatments. Each tray is customized to your teeth and your requirements.

Therefore, don't rule out the possibility of aligners just because your teeth seem "too complicated."  Many cases that formerly required braces can now be handled with aligners.

Myth 2: Aligners Are Not as Effective as Braces
Ah! The debate of aligners vs braces! People believe braces must be more dependable because they are more established and well-known.

The Reality: Braces and aligners both function equally well. How they fit into your lifestyle makes a difference. The aligners employ detachable transparent trays, and braces use wires and brackets. In many instances, the outcomes can be equally effective.

When deciding between braces and aligners, consider your daily schedule. Would you like something nearly undetectable? Would you like to eat anything you want?  Do you want cleaning to be simpler? If so, clear aligners provide such benefits.

Myth 3: Aligners Cause Excruciating Pain

A lot of folks are afraid that aligners would cause too much pain.

The Reality: Aligners do apply mild pressure to your teeth, particularly when you move to a new set of trays. That's how they position your teeth. But they don't have brackets or wires that prod your cheeks or gums like braces do.

For a day or two, most patients report the sensation as tightness rather than acute pain.  You barely notice them after that. It's not so much agony as it is a period of adjustment.

Myth 4: You Have to Wear Aligners Every Day
Some individuals believe that teeth aligners must remain in the mouth continuously throughout the day.

The Reality: 20 to 22 hours a day is the recommended amount of time to wear the aligners every day. This implies that you can take them off while cleaning your teeth, eating, or drinking anything other than water. You don't have to give up your favorite sticky sweets, crunchy nibbles, or traditional Indian cuisine.

When compared to braces, aligners are far more enticing because of their flexibility.  You don't have to worry about dietary limits, as you can still enjoy your regular meals.

Myth 5: The Cost of Teeth Aligners Is Always High

The misconception is that because aligners are so expensive, they are unaffordable.

The Reality: The teeth aligners cost is determined by the clinic you select and your unique dental requirements. In recent years, aligners have become significantly more affordable. Additionally, a lot of clinics let you pay in installments. This makes managing treatment simpler.

Consider it as an investment in long-term oral health, comfort, and confidence in addition to paying for straighter teeth.

Myth 6: Using Aligners Eliminates the Need for Visits to Dentists
People believe that trips to the dentist are unnecessary because they receive multiple trays at once.

The Reality: Even though aligners are made to be more convenient, your dentist must still keep an eye on your progress. Regular dental exams make sure your teeth are moving in the right direction. Sometimes, small changes are occasionally required to keep things moving forward.

Missing dental appointments might cause issues or possibly postpone your results.  Therefore, you still need expert supervision to achieve the perfect teeth alignment you desire.

Myth 7: You are Not Able to Eat or Drink Normally

It is widely believed that aligners entail numerous dietary restrictions.

The Reality: Foods that are sticky, tough, or chewy must be avoided when wearing braces. Whereas you can eat anything you want with aligners without worrying. Even crunchy snacks and sweets are allowed.

The only restriction is to avoid eating or drinking anything other than water while wearing them, as this may cause damage or discoloration to the trays. So, you just need to remember to take off your aligners before eating. After finishing, wash or rinse your teeth and replace the aligners. Easy and stress-free!
